Simmer or bake something. Simmering water that’s mixed with a few slices of oranges and lemons, cinnamon sticks, and bay leaves is a recipe for a great scent. Check out these 5 Simmer Pot Recipes that are bound to be some of your favorites!

 

Baking something like bread, brownies, or cookies is also a great way to fill your apartment with a delicious scent.

 

Light a candle. Lighting a candle is probably the first thing that comes to mind when people want to “freshen up” their apartment with a good clean scent. Candles come in a variety of yummy scents and can be surprisingly affordable. While they’re generally pretty small in size, candles pack a powerful aroma. One candle can fill a room and even more with its flavorful scent.

 

But candles are for more than just a good scent. The flicker of light from a candle can create a wonderful ambiance to any room.

 

Make your own reed diffuser. These are fairly simple to make since you probably have almost everything lying around your apartment. All you need is a glass or ceramic container with a narrow opening (do you have a vase that you’re not using?), essential oils, mineral oil, and reeds or bamboo skewers. For complete instructions, take a look at apartment therapy’s article titled How to Make Homemade Reed Diffusers.

 

Reed diffusers are a popular trend in apartment fragrancing. After the reeds or bamboo skewers are placed in the container, the scent of the oil inside disperses naturally into the air. These “flame-free candles” are quite effective and look great.
